Senco Gold & Diamonds launched an AI-powered styling feature called Shape of You on March 5, 2026, positioning the tool as the company's first technology-driven styling concept and timing the release ahead of International Women's Day. The feature, available in select Senco showrooms and on the Senco mobile application, uses face-scanning and analysis to assess a customer's facial structure, proportions, and contours before recommending earring and necklace silhouettes calibrated to complement those specific features.

The underlying logic is straightforward but the application is precise: the system suggests elongated styles for softer contours, curved designs for angular faces, and statement pieces where visual harmony requires it. Recommendations are built around balance and form rather than seasonal trend cycles, a deliberate departure from the outfit-led approach that has long governed how Indian women select jewellery.

Joita Sen, Director and Head of Marketing and Design at Senco Gold and Diamonds, described the concept in terms that sit closer to design philosophy than product feature. "Design is about understanding before it is about creation," she said. "Jewellery should feel right not because it is trendy, but because it reflects who you are. With The Shape of You, we've translated instinctive responses to form, interpreting facial structure and proportion into a more confident, intuitive jewellery experience, where design works in harmony with the face and the woman wearing it. That's the Senco difference: where design, heritage craftsmanship and insight come together to create jewellery that doesn't just adorn you, it celebrates you."

Suvankar Sen, MD and CEO of Senco Gold & Diamonds, framed the tool within a broader technology investment. "Often, women instinctively know when a piece of jewellery feels right, even if they cannot explain why. The Shape of You is one of our many technology applications for better customer experience and to drive unique service to customers," he said.

That claim of institutional instinct finding a technological expression is central to how Senco is positioning the launch. The company, a pan-India retailer with a stated legacy of more than eighty-five years, described Shape of You as built on what it calls refined karigari and a deep understanding of Indian aesthetics. The juxtaposition of face-scanning software and traditional craftsmanship is a deliberate one: the brand is not presenting this as a pivot away from heritage but as an extension of it.

Several questions the launch does not yet answer are worth noting. Senco has not publicly named the AI or computer vision vendor behind the face-scanning engine, and the company has not detailed its data privacy or image-retention policies for customers who use the feature in-store or through the app. The specific showrooms currently offering the tool have not been listed, and it remains unclear whether the system's recommendations connect directly to in-stock inventory or function as a purely stylistic guide.

What is clear is the direction Senco is moving. For a category that has historically sold through emotional impulse and occasion, the introduction of structural, face-geometry logic into the recommendation process marks a genuine shift in how a major Indian jewellery retailer is thinking about the moment of selection.
